We fast on Ashura to attain Allah’s nearness in this time, and nearness is that Allah is with you—this nearness that makes you recognize the truth and steadies you upon it.
Often we complain that we have strayed and become confused, no longer knowing where the truth lies, while desires and doubts have taken hold of us. Here fasting becomes the main means of increasing God-consciousness, as He the Exalted has said:
O you who believe, fasting has been prescribed for you as it was prescribed for those before you, so that you may become God-conscious. (2:183)
God-consciousness is the path that leads to Allah’s nearness, as He has said in His decisive revelation:
Know that Allah is with those who are God-conscious. (2:186)
Moreover, God-consciousness is the reason Allah makes for you a “criterion” by which you can distinguish right from wrong, as He has said:
O you who believe, if you are God-conscious of Allah, He will grant you a criterion. (8:29)
